多线程文件传输V2.2 支持断点续传 收发消息 点对多点 完整源代码(C/C++)

时间:2012-05-28 06:34:27
【文件属性】:

文件名称:多线程文件传输V2.2 支持断点续传 收发消息 点对多点 完整源代码(C/C++)

文件大小:262KB

文件格式:ZIP

更新时间:2012-05-28 06:34:27

阻塞方式 断点续传 点对多点

完整源代码版本2.2 C/C++实现,包括完整源代码,vc工程文件,保证能够编译通过。 使用阻塞方式的socket,使用多线程,有较高的性能. 在局域网中测试达到极限速度. 支持断点续传. 服务端可同时接收多个文件. 传输文件的同时可以发送网络消息. 用户界面与后台线程交互 如有问题请与我联系: hongxing777@gmail.com


【文件预览】:
socket-file-transfer
----Send()
--------StdAfx.h(1KB)
--------Thread.h(502B)
--------Release()
--------res()
--------TcpClient.cpp(26KB)
--------Send.dsp(4KB)
--------SendDlg.h(2KB)
--------Send.sln(897B)
--------Thread.cpp(714B)
--------Resource.h(1KB)
--------Send.h(1KB)
--------Send.cpp(2KB)
--------Send.dsw(533B)
--------TcpClient.h(8KB)
--------Send.vcproj(7KB)
--------SendDlg.cpp(7KB)
--------StdAfx.cpp(206B)
--------Send.rc(6KB)
--------Send.suo(10KB)
----Recv()
--------StdAfx.h(1KB)
--------Thread.h(502B)
--------Release()
--------Recv.rc(5KB)
--------res()
--------SysUtils.cpp(7KB)
--------Recv.h(1KB)
--------Recv.cpp(2KB)
--------Thread.cpp(714B)
--------RecvDlg.cpp(8KB)
--------Resource.h(1KB)
--------Recv.dsp(4KB)
--------RecvDlg.h(2KB)
--------StdAfx.cpp(206B)
--------TcpServer.cpp(34KB)
--------TcpServer.h(13KB)
--------SysUtils.h(828B)
--------Recv.dsw(533B)

网友评论

  • 没看清是C/C++
  • 很好,非常不错,谢谢分享
  • 挺好的 可以用 但就是不知道怎么传文件
  • 代码很不错,可以正常使用
  • 可以实现不过有点乱
  • 这个积分有点高啊,但是还可以
  • 断点续传,正是我想要的
  • 断点续传,正是我想要的
  • 可以正常使用
  • 有可取之处,但Ctcgclient太仲,好多功能不应该放在这
  • 发送和接收都可以编译通过。可以传文件。 不过发送对象和保存地不能浏览选取。 有时间我修改一下